Description
Course description
The course focuses on recognizing their competence in the skills required for successful academic studies in multilingual and multicultural contexts. The students learn the basics of group communication skills, and practice both giving and receiving constructive feedback.
Main content
- Reflection of strengths and weaknesses
- Basics of group dynamics and group communication skills within multilingual and intercultural contexts.
- Constructive feedback
Learning outcomes
On completion of the course, the student is expected to:
- identify their strengths and areas for development in communication competence
- learned about group communication competence within multilingual and multicultural contexts
- be able to give and receive constructive feedback
- have gained general academic readiness and know academic culture in JYU
- understand the concept and aims of the programme
- be able to reflect on their goals for the Bachelor’s Programme and identify their strengths and areas for development
